1. Set the Right Price
One of the key factors in attracting potential buyers is setting the right price for your Maryland house. To determine a competitive asking price, it’s crucial to research the market value of similar properties in your area. This will give you an idea of what buyers are willing to pay.
Consider pricing your house slightly below market value to create a sense of urgency and attract more buyers. While it may seem counterintuitive to price your house lower than what you think it’s worth, it can actually lead to a faster sale. Buyers are more likely to make an offer if they feel they’re getting a good deal.
To get more accurate pricing guidance, consult with a real estate agent who specializes in the Maryland market. They have the expertise and knowledge to help you determine the optimal price for your house based on current market trends.
2. Enhance Curb Appeal
First impressions matter, and the exterior of your house is the first thing potential buyers will see. Enhancing the curb appeal of your Maryland house can make a significant difference in attracting buyers and increasing the chances of a fast sale.
Start by thoroughly cleaning up the exterior of your house. Pressure wash the driveway, walkways, and siding to remove dirt and grime. Make sure the windows are clean and sparkling. Pay attention to details like the front door, mailbox, and house numbers. A fresh coat of paint or new hardware can give your house a renewed look.
Landscape and maintain your yard to create an inviting atmosphere. Trim bushes and trees, mow the lawn, and plant flowers or add potted plants for a burst of color. Investing in small improvements to the exterior, such as replacing outdated light fixtures or repairing a cracked driveway, can also make a big impact.
3. Stage the Interior
Once potential buyers step inside your Maryland house, you want to create a space that feels welcoming and allows them to envision themselves living there. Staging the interior is a powerful tool to showcase the full potential of your house and make it more appealing to buyers.
Start by decluttering and depersonalizing your home. Remove personal items and excessive decorations to create a clean and neutral canvas. This allows buyers to imagine their own belongings in the space. Consider renting a storage unit to temporarily store any excess furniture or items that may be distracting.
Arrange furniture strategically to maximize space and flow. Remove any oversized or unnecessary furniture to create a sense of openness. Rearrange furniture to create functional and inviting spaces, such as a cozy reading nook or a dining area.
Add tasteful decor to enhance the appeal of each room. Consider adding fresh flowers, scented candles, or artwork to add warmth and personality. Remember to keep everything clean and well-maintained throughout the selling process.
4. Market Strategically
To sell your Maryland house fast, it’s essential to market it effectively. By reaching a wide audience, you increase the chances of finding the right buyer quickly. Here are some strategies to consider:
- List your Maryland house on multiple online platforms, such as real estate websites, social media, and local listings. This ensures maximum exposure and increases the likelihood of attracting potential buyers.
- Utilize professional photography to showcase your house in the best possible light. High-quality images can make a significant difference in grabbing buyers’ attention and generating interest.
- Consider virtual tours or 3D walkthroughs to provide potential buyers with an immersive experience. This allows them to explore your house remotely and get a better sense of its layout and features.
- Leverage social media platforms to reach a wider audience. Create eye-catching posts with engaging captions and hashtags to attract potential buyers who may not be actively searching for a house but could be interested in your property.
5. Consider Cash Buyers
If you’re looking to sell your Maryland house quickly and avoid the traditional selling process, consider cash buyers. Cash buying companies in Maryland provide an alternative option that can expedite the sale of your house.
Research reputable cash buying companies in Maryland and contact multiple for competitive offers. These companies typically buy houses as-is, so you don’t have to worry about making repairs or staging the property. While the offered price may be lower than what you could potentially get on the market, the convenience and speed of the transaction may outweigh that difference.
When evaluating offers from cash buyers, pay close attention to the terms and conditions. Some cash buyers may offer a quick sale but have unfavorable terms, such as excessive fees or a long closing period. It’s important to assess the overall package and choose the option that aligns best with your goals and timeline.
6. Be Flexible with Showings
To sell your Maryland house fast, it’s crucial to be accommodating and flexible with potential buyers’ schedules. Make sure your house is always clean, tidy, and ready for showings.
Even if it may be inconvenient at times, try to accommodate requests for showings as much as possible. Potential buyers may have limited availability, and you don’t want to miss out on potential offers. Keep in mind that the more showings you have, the higher the chances of finding the right buyer quickly.
Consider offering virtual showings as an added convenience. This allows potential buyers to view your house remotely, which can be particularly helpful for out-of-town buyers or during times when physical visits may be challenging.
7. Work with a Real Estate Agent
Working with a real estate agent can significantly streamline the selling process and increase the likelihood of a fast sale. Here’s why you should consider partnering with an experienced agent in Maryland:
- Choose an experienced agent familiar with the Maryland market. They have deep knowledge about local market trends, pricing strategies, and buyer preferences. This expertise can help you navigate the selling process more effectively.
- Utilize the agent’s network and resources for marketing your Maryland house. Agents have access to multiple listing services, connections with other agents, and a pool of potential buyers. They can leverage these resources to generate more interest in your property.
- Benefit from their negotiation skills during the selling process. Negotiating with buyers can be complex, and having an experienced agent by your side can help you secure the best possible offer. They can also guide you on how to handle counteroffers and ensure a smooth closing process.
